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's)

The Rheumatoid Factor (RF) test is a blood test that measures the level of RF antibodies in your blood. These antibodies are proteins produced by your immune system that attack healthy tissues in your body, including joints and organs.

 

While the Rheumatoid factor (RF) test is a useful tool in diagnosing rheumatoid arthritis (RA), it does have its limitations. One of these limitations is that not all individuals with RA will test positive for RF. In fact, up to 30% of people with RA will have negative results on their RF tests.

 

Factors that may prompt a doctor to order an RA factor test include family history of RA or other autoimmune diseases, presence of nodules under the skin, and persistent fatigue or weakness.

 

Certain medications such as biologic drugs, corticosteroids and disease-modifying antirheumatic drugs (DMARDs) can interfere with the test and produce inaccurate results.

 

RF tests  alone cannot be relied upon to diagnose RA with complete accuracy. In fact, it has been found that up to 30% of patients who do not have RA may still show positive results on an RF test. This means that relying solely on an RF test may lead to misdiagnosis and unnecessary treatment.

 

Fasting isn't necessary for RA factor tests; however, you should still follow your healthcare provider's instructions regarding food intake before testing.

#1 Rheumatoid Factor test means

Ans: The Rheumatoid factor test is a blood test that measures the level of rheumatoid factor (RF) in your body. RF is an autoantibody - a type of protein produced by your immune system that mistakenly attacks healthy tissues, leading to inflammation and joint damage.

#2 Rheumatoid Factor test results

Ans: After taking a Rheumatoid factor test, the results will show whether or not you have high levels of rheumatoid factor in your blood. The results are usually reported as positive or negative.

#4 Rheumatoid Factor test normal range

Ans: The normal range for this test varies depending on the laboratory that performs it, but generally a result less than 14 IU/mL is considered negative.
